Side-by-Side Comparison
| Feature | contener | convencer |
|---|---|---|
| Definition | Llevar en su interior, tener dentro de sí. | Forzar o persuadir a otra persona con argumentos y pruebas a que piense o proceda de acuerdo con éstos. |

Why the eye confuses contener with convencer
A purely visual mix-up. contener ([kõn̪t̪eˈneɾ]) and convencer ([kõmbẽnˈseɾ])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they differ by 1 letter(s) in length. Our composite confusion score for this pair is 11417, derived from the frequency rank of both members and their visual similarity.
contener is recorded at frequency rank #5,936, classified as averb, pronounced [kõn̪t̪eˈneɾ]. convencer is at rank #5,481, tagged as averb, pronounced [kõmbẽnˈseɾ].
